Waste incineration has long been used as a method of disposing of waste and reducing its volume. However, traditional waste incinerators can be expensive to operate and maintain, as well as having negative environmental impacts. Fortunately, there are several cost-effective alternatives to traditional waste incinerators that can help reduce waste and lower costs.
Biomass Gasification
Biomass gasification is a process that converts organic materials, such as agricultural residue and woody materials, into a clean-burning gas that can be used for energy production. This method is relatively low-cost and can help reduce waste while producing renewable energy.
Composting
Composting is a natural process that breaks down organic waste into nutrient-rich soil. This method is cost-effective and can help divert organic waste from landfills, reducing methane emissions and producing valuable compost for gardening and agriculture.
Anaerobic Digestion
Anaerobic digestion is a process that breaks down organic waste in the absence of oxygen, producing biogas that can be used for energy production. This method is cost-effective and can help reduce waste while producing renewable energy and valuable byproducts such as fertilizer.
Recycling
Recycling is a well-known method of reducing waste and conserving resources. By recycling materials such as paper, glass, and plastic, valuable resources can be recovered and reused, reducing the need for new raw materials and lowering overall waste production.
